Subject: Pinning policy change — Quillbase plugin SDK

Effective next release, all Quillbase plugins must pin exact SDK versions; ranges and floating tags will be rejected at publish time. Transitive deps are resolved from our frozen lockfile, not upstream. Update your manifests before the cutover or CI will fail your submission. The enforcing toolchain build is listed below.

build token for tawip-yageg: htk9_92ac43d42

// Initializes the client for the Vantlow Garage occupancy feed.
// The feed is produced by loop sensors at each ramp and aggregated
// by the Bayfill service; counts can drift slightly during shift
// changes, so downstream consumers should smooth over 5-minute
// windows. Retries use exponential backoff capped at two minutes.
// The client authenticates to Bayfill's internal endpoint with the
// key directly below.

service key, kawip-kahop: kto4_QQzB

The Farelab ticket-pricing experiment service rejected last night's config push with a signature mismatch, so the new fare variants never went live and all venues fell back to baseline pricing. Root cause: the config was signed with the retired staging key after last week's rotation. No customer-facing pricing errors occurred. Support should tell experimenters to re-sign configs with the current key and resubmit; pushes verified against it deploy normally. The active verification key is below.

release key, bahof-hafog: bky3_ztf

For the weekly sync: the Ferrygate SFTP drop used by our Bramblehook partner feed has drifted from the values in source control. Sometime in the last month, someone hand-edited the retry interval and the chroot path on the production host, and the nightly pulls have been intermittently failing since. Audit logging wasn't enabled, so we can't attribute the change. Proposal: revert to the committed baseline and lock the host config. For reference, the current live settings on the box are as follows.

service settings:
[casax]
port = 6379
team = rusir
host = casax.zemvarhq.corp
region = outer-4
access_code = ac_9808ce
timeout_ms = 1500